Sun Soaked and Serene Seaside Sanctuary

Serenely set in the vibrant heart of Sandringham Village, this welcoming, sun splashed apartment offers comfort, practicality, and an exceptional lifestyle experience, just moments from the beach.

A tiled entrance hall flows past a concealed Euro laundry and sleek fully tiled bathroom before arriving at the generous open plan living, dining, and kitchen zone.

The stone finished kitchen reveals Smeg gas cooktop and microwave, Bosch oven and rangehood, integrated Fisher and Paykel fridge/freezer, glass splashback, and plentiful cabinetry, while the living and dining area is bathed in natural light and features a split system air conditioner, a gas fireplace and custom fitted cabinetry.

Flowing seamlessly from the indoors through glass sliders, a generous and sunny full-width entertainment terrace provides a wonderful indoor-outdoor connection with lovely green outlooks.

The main bedroom, with extensive built in robes, also effortlessly transitions to the al fresco terrace.

Complemented by security intercom, one basement car space, and a storage cage.

At this convenient beachside locale, mere footsteps to shops, cafes, restaurants, boutiques, the beach, plus the city bound train and bus services.

A block's planning zone defines how that land can be used and what can be built on it.
A right to use a part of land owned by another person for a specific purpose. The most common forms of easements are for services, such as water, electricity or sewerage.
The value of a block of land without any buildings, landscaping, paths, or fences. This is different to the block's market value. A block's unimproved value is used to calculate rates and land tax charges.
This represents the shape of the geographical land. Closely spaced contour lines represent a steep slope. Widely spaced lines represent a gentle slope.
